Skip to main content
All CollectionsCustomize the Appearance of your Schedule
How do I embed my Punchpass schedule on a Wordpress website?
How do I embed my Punchpass schedule on a Wordpress website?

If your website was built on Wordpress, this is how you'll add your Punchpass schedule to it.

Chris avatar
Written by Chris
Updated over a year ago

Here are instructions on how to embed your Punchpass class schedule on your Wordpress website.
โ€‹

Note: This is for Wordpress.org sites; websites that use Wordpress through a website hosting provider.

Right now you cannot embed Punchpass on websites hosted on Wordpress.com. Contact us if you aren't sure!

Install the iframe plugin

Punchpass uses something called an iframe to let you put your schedule on your own website. Think of an iframe like a web-based picture frame that can show content from another website. In order to use one on Wordpress you need to install the iframe plugin.

Open your Wordpress admin console, and click on the Plugins link on the left side. Search for 'iframe.'

The iframe plugin should be the first one to come up - the arrow is pointing to the correct one to install.

Click Install Now. You'll then need to Activate the plugin, and may also be asked to empty the page cache. (There will be a button to click to clear it if asked.)

Paste the embed code

Now open the page where you are going to embed your schedule. We recommend putting your schedule on a page, not a post, as that puts the schedule in a fixed location that will appear on your navigation bar.

The embed code for your Punchpass schedule can be found under Manage > Settings > Embedding Punchpass. You can choose your preferred view, we've given you the code for both a list and calendar version):

You will need to change the < to [ around your iframe code for Wordpress to read it correctly!

Paste your preferred embed code on your Wordpress page and save!

Did this answer your question?